What Is Hellstar?

Hellstar is a streetwear brand with a futuristic and spiritual twist. Its motto—“Born into Hell, Designed for the Stars”—sums it up perfectly. It speaks to struggle, transformation, and rising above your circumstances. The brand embraces duality: light and dark, pain and progress, earth and cosmos.

Founded in the U.S., Hellstar’s designs are heavily inspired by space, religion, philosophy, and emotional storytelling. It’s clothing that makes you think—and makes you look twice.


The Hellstar Aesthetic

Hellstar’s aesthetic is instantly recognizable. It’s loud, abstract, and often intense—but it always has a purpose. Here’s what defines the brand’s visual identity:

Celestial Themes

Hellstar lives in the stars. Think planets, constellations, solar flares, and galaxies printed across tees and hoodies. These designs create a vibe that feels otherworldly and prophetic.

Religious & Symbolic Imagery

From crucifixes and angel wings to skeletons and flames, Hellstar leans into spiritual and gothic themes. It’s not necessarily about religion—it’s about inner conflict, growth, and reflection.

Heavy Graphics

Large back prints, dramatic front visuals, and hand-drawn-style artwork dominate Hellstar’s pieces. They tell a story, often without words.

Dark Colors & Neon Highlights

Most Hellstar drops include blacks, greys, and deep purples, contrasted with neon greens, reds, or metallic ink. The contrast creates an intense visual experience—like staring into space or fire.

Limited Drops & Hype Culture

Hellstar Tracksuit follows the streetwear formula of scarcity and exclusivity. Most of their collections are released in limited quantities and sell out quickly. Here’s what keeps the demand high:

  • No Mass Production: Once it’s gone, it’s gone. This keeps Hellstar items rare and desirable.
  • Surprise Drops: Releases are often teased on Instagram or hinted at in cryptic posts.
  • Collaborations: Hellstar has teased or worked with creatives in music and fashion to keep the brand fresh and unpredictable.

Fans treat each drop like an event—marking their calendars, setting reminders, and jumping on the site the moment it goes live.
